Verb Meaning(s): to stick, to hit, to glue
Verb Chart: Pegar Future Tense
Yo | pegaré I will hit | Nosotros | pegaremos we will hit |
Tú (Juana, Juan) | pegarás you will hit | Vosotros (informal Spain) | pegaréis you all will hit |
Él/Ella/Ud. (Sra./Dr. García) | pegará he/she/you will hit | Ellos/Ellas/Uds. | pegarán they/you all will hit |

2. ¿Tú pegarás las fotos en el álbum de recuerdos?
Will you glue the photos into the scrapbook?
3. Él pegará un golpe fuerte en el partido de mañana.
He will deliver a strong hit in tomorrow’s game.
4. Ella pegará etiquetas en los frascos de mermelada casera.
She will stick labels on the jars of homemade jam.
5. Usted pegará los pedazos del jarrón roto, ¿verdad?
You will glue the pieces of the broken vase, right?

7. Vosotros pegaréis estampas en vuestras cartas. (vosotros is used only in Spain)
You will stick stamps on your letters.
8. Ellos pegarán un salto en sus carreras después de este proyecto.
They will make a leap in their careers after this project.
9. Ellas pegarán decoraciones en las paredes para la fiesta.
They will stick decorations on the walls for the party.
10. ¿Ustedes pegarán los nuevos horarios en el tablón de anuncios?
Will you pin the new schedules on the bulletin board?
